Sydney flights will most likely land at Sydney Airport, located just a little bit outside of the main part of the Sydney. Travellers who embark from one of the many cheap flights to Sydney will find plenty of options for transport into the main part of the city. There is a rail terminal right at the airport which links to Sydney, and there are several bus options available. Visitors can also rent a car or bicycle to travel into the city, though that isn't recommended for passengers with a lot of bags.
Visitors to Sydney will discover a large, sprawling metropolitan location with several useful options for ground transportation. Sydney's many highways and roads make for a good driving city, if you feel like renting a car for your travels. There is also an extensive rail system in an around Sydney; CityRail and the Metro Light Rail trains provide efficient, quick transport to most of the city's hotspots. The city also has a very large bus network which will take you to the few places the Metro Rail might not cover. Sydney also boasts an active and vibrant bicycling culture, so if you're a two-wheel fan, try renting a bike to get around town.

The most famous structure in all of Sydney is undoubtedly the Sydney Opera House, the gorgeously-designed building located right next to the Sydney Harbour. If you can get a ticket, stop in to see one of the House's acclaimed productions - the building hosts orchestra music, ballet, theatre and opera. That's not all there is to see in the city. Sydney also boasts extraordinary beaches perfect for sunbathers, as well as Luna Park - a perfect place to take the whole family. The city also offers the amazing Royal Botanical Gardens, sightseeing at the Sydney Tower, casino action at Darling Harbour, tons of aquatic entertainment options and some amazing museums. The Australians know how to have a good time! Make sure you take advantage of the whole city. As the hub of Australia, Sydney offers some incredible nightlife attractions. You can catch a show or performance at one of Sydney's many acclaimed theatres - oftentimes featuring some of the country's famous actors and actresses - or head out to party at the Darling Harbour district, Kings Cross District or Oxford Street, all full of exciting bars and restaurants. Shoppers will want to head to the Surry Hills or Paddington districts for great bargains, or trek to Westfield Sydney for all the top international brands. Oh, and don't forget the food! Sydney is full of amazing cuisine, with world-class restaurants all across the city. Be sure to try some of the fresh seafood or Asian cuisine offered at places like The Summit or Wagaya (in Chinatown). Oh, and if you're feeling adventurous - go ahead and sample some kangaroo meat!
